Stunning Landmarks and Must-See Attractions
Agadir is a city of contrasts, where historic sites stand proudly alongside contemporary marvels. Some of its most captivating landmarks include:
The Agadir Kasbah: Perched on a hilltop, this ancient fortress offers breathtaking panoramic views of the city and the Atlantic Ocean. It is a reminder of Agadir’s storied past and a perfect spot for sunset admirers.
The Marina of Agadir: A modern and sophisticated harbor lined with chic cafés, restaurants, and luxury yachts, creating an atmosphere of elegance and leisure.
The Medina Polizzi: A recreated traditional medina that reflects Morocco’s architectural heritage, designed by the famous architect Coco Polizzi.
The Crocoparc: A unique wildlife attraction where visitors can admire Nile crocodiles and explore lush botanical gardens filled with exotic plants.
The Amazigh Heritage Museum: A tribute to the indigenous Berber culture, displaying fascinating artifacts, jewelry, and ancient crafts.

The Culinary Delights of Agadir
Agadir is a haven for food lovers, offering an exceptional variety of Moroccan and international cuisine. Fresh seafood is a highlight, with local fishermen bringing in the day’s catch to be served in waterfront restaurants.
Traditional Moroccan dishes, such as tagines, couscous, and pastilla, are prepared with aromatic spices and slow-cooked to perfection. Visitors can also enjoy sweet delights like honey-drenched pastries and refreshing mint tea, served with the warmth and hospitality that Morocco is famous for.
